Come along to our meetups to improve your art in a relaxed and social atmosphere and under the guidance of a professional instructor. Complete beginners to experienced artists all welcome.

Our 2 hour meetups are held in a different location each time, usually outdoors.

Bring your own materials. If you are a complete beginner all you need to start is a set of watercolour paints, brushes, and water container.

Who can attend? Open to all skill levels, from beginners to experienced artists. The instructor is there to help everyone.

Adelaide Watercolour Group
2025-04-21
Title or Location: Late Mornings Cafe
A Duplex owner decided to run a cafe in the CBD. It became very successful with people gathering all hours of the morning. I had an hour to wait for an appointment in town, so I sketched this on location. DS watercolour on 300gsm cotton.

Dallas Watercolor Group
2025-04-18
Title or Location: View From Dugout Wells
Located in Big Bend Nat'l Park, TX., Dugout Wells has a working windmill, providing water to the small parcel of desert surrounding it. The view of the Chisos Mountain Range was spectacular on this cool windy morning. I have painted at this spot on several occasions. 10 x 14 watercolor.
